Jonathan Greenard Bio
Jonathan Raymond Greenard is an American professional football linebacker for the Minnesota Vikings of the National Football League (NFL). He played college football for the Louisville Cardinals and the Florida Gators. Known for his defensive skills, Greenard has made significant contributions to his teams since entering the NFL in 2020. His career is marked by notable achievements, including a Pro Bowl selection in 2024 and recognition as a First-team All-SEC player in 2019.
Early Life and Background
Jonathan Greenard was born on May 25, 1997, in Hiram, Georgia. He attended Hiram High School, where he excelled in both basketball and football. As a senior, he earned the title of 5-A regional defensive player of the year, showcasing his talent on the field. Rated as a three-star recruit, Greenard committed to play college football at the University of Louisville over other schools, including the University of Kentucky.
Path to American Football
Greenard began his college career at Louisville, where he redshirted his true freshman season. He quickly became a key reserve at linebacker, recording 22 tackles, including seven for loss, and 2.5 sacks during his redshirt freshman year. His performance earned him a starting position, and he led the team in tackles and sacks during his sophomore season. Unfortunately, an injury in his junior year sidelined him for the entire season, prompting his transfer to the University of Florida.
Jonathan Greenard Career
Early Career (2020-2023)
Jonathan Greenard was drafted by the Houston Texans in the third round of the 2020 NFL Draft, being the 90th overall pick. He signed a four-year contract with the Texans, which included a signing bonus of nearly $900,000. Greenard made his NFL debut on October 4, 2020, against the Minnesota Vikings. In his rookie season, he recorded 19 tackles, two tackles for loss, and one sack over 13 games.
Breakthrough (2024-Present)
Greenard’s breakthrough came in 2024 when he signed a four-year, $76 million contract with the Minnesota Vikings. In Week 3 of the 2024 season, he showcased his skills by recording three sacks and four tackles in a game against the Texans, earning the title of NFC Defensive Player of the Week. His performance has solidified his reputation as a formidable linebacker in the league.
